Debt Cover

Debt

by David Graeber

Buy Debt by David Graeber on Amazon

and I'd recommend another book which is David graber's debt the first 5,000 years which looks at what you do with debt system systems from a very long-term perspective and makes a point about the fact that debt is always about power

The guest recommends this book for its long-term perspective on debt and power.

General Theory Of Employment , Interest And Money Cover

General Theory Of Employment , Interest And Money

by John Maynard Keynes

Buy General Theory Of Employment , Interest And Money by John Maynard Keynes on Amazon

and as someone who also spend a lot of time thinking about economic history and is head of King's College in Cambridge which was where John Min kanes was based I'm also haunted by the fact that in 1919 after World War One John man KES wrote a haunting pamphlet called The Economic Consequences of the Peace in which he pointed out that globalization preor War I had been very good for people so had had free markets and the free movement of people and Innovation and that had delivered a huge economic boom that was obviously disrupted after World War I

The guest mentions John Maynard Keynes wrote this pamphlet after WWI and its relevance to current protectionist policies.
